Week 1 - Nate
I didn’t make it out today to take pictures like I wanted to so instead I’m going to post one I took last Saturday during the snowstorm. This is a from a field just outside my apartment. There were about 15 bunnies running around but I found this one just watching all the fun.
Snow Bunny
Canon Rebel XT w/ 70-300mm IS
Taken at 300mm, f/5.6, 1/2500 sec, ISO 200
Post: Bumped the exposure up a bit and cropped some off the top
Week 01 - Jordan
My photo this week is a result of last night’s festivities with bacon.
Canon XSi with 50mm f/1.8 II @ 50mm f/1.8 1/30s ISO 400
I like the lighting coming from behind the bowl of pork and I’m pleased with the sharpness in the middle.
If I was able to do it again, I’d increase the depth of field so all of it was sharp and I’d move the placemat out of the top right corner. I might even polish up the bowl a bit more and remove the stray sauce on the left.
